Output 62834fbe5bad7204049534c9142972ab2f8200bbe0bc1234caa7dd9fa0389496:0

value
10656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6968ba851af0d4fa193066ade292cd8022a09d4b OP_EQUAL
address
3BJNLMcVVWJHLoqkUTJTbgxDFa74fHSdvJ
transaction
62834fbe5bad7204049534c9142972ab2f8200bbe0bc1234caa7dd9fa0389496
confirmations
287587
spent
true